feat(compression): raise compaction trigger to 85% for gpt-5.5 on Codex OAuth (#40957)

The ChatGPT Codex OAuth backend hard-caps gpt-5.5 at a 272K context window
(verified live: a ~330K-token request to chatgpt.com/backend-api/codex/responses
is rejected with context_length_exceeded while ~250K succeeds; the same slug
exposes 1.05M on the direct OpenAI API / OpenRouter and 400K on Copilot). At the
default 50% trigger, auto-compaction fires at ~136K — half the usable window.

Raise the trigger to 85% (~231K) on this exact route only, gated by a new
compression.codex_gpt55_autoraise config flag (default true). When it fires,
emit a one-time notice (CLI inline print + gateway status_callback replay) with
the exact opt-back-out command. gpt-5.5 on any other provider keeps the user's
global threshold.

- _is_codex_gpt55() matches the 5.5 family only on provider=openai-codex
- _compression_threshold_for_model() now provider-aware + opt-out param
- config key + _config_version bump (27->28) for backfill
- docs + tests (40 cases in test_arcee_trinity_overrides.py)

### Codex gpt-5.5 threshold autoraise
The ChatGPT Codex OAuth backend hard-caps gpt-5.5 at a **272K** context window
(the same slug exposes 1.05M on OpenAI's direct API and OpenRouter, and 400K on
GitHub Copilot). At the default 50% trigger, compaction would fire at ~136K —
half the window the model can actually use. When the active route is Codex
OAuth (`provider: openai-codex`) and the model is gpt-5.5, Hermes raises the
trigger to **85%** (~231K) and prints a one-time notice with the opt-out
command. Only this exact route is affected; gpt-5.5 on any other provider keeps
your global `threshold`. To opt back down to the global value:
```bash
hermes config set compression.codex_gpt55_autoraise false
```
